Full ReviewAdobe Analytics is an enterprise-grade web analytics and marketing analytics platform that is part of the Adobe Experience Cloud. It provides advanced segmentation, real-time reporting, customer journey analysis, attribution modeling, and predictive analytics capabilities that go well beyond basic web analytics. MailerCheck is an email verification and list cleaning service that validates email addresses to identify invalid, disposable, role-based, and risky addresses, helping businesses maintain clean email lists and protect sender reputation.
Connecting Adobe Analytics and MailerCheck creates a powerful analytics feedback loop for email marketing. By combining Adobe Analytics website behavior data with MailerCheck email verification results, you can understand the relationship between email list quality and website engagement. This reveals whether visitors who provide valid email addresses exhibit different behavior patterns than those who submit invalid or disposable addresses, and helps optimize both your email acquisition strategy and your overall marketing spend.
For enterprise marketing teams already invested in the Adobe ecosystem, this integration adds an email quality dimension to their analytics. Understanding which traffic sources, landing pages, and campaigns generate the highest-quality email sign-ups allows teams to allocate budget more effectively and improve the lifetime value of their email subscriber base.

Adobe Analytics and MailerCheck do not have a native integration. Adobe Analytics is designed to integrate within the Adobe Experience Cloud ecosystem and with enterprise data platforms, while MailerCheck is a specialized email verification service. Connecting them requires a data pipeline approach.
The most effective method is to feed MailerCheck verification results into a data layer or data warehouse that Adobe Analytics can access. For enterprise setups, use Adobe Analytics Data Insertion API or Classifications to import MailerCheck data alongside existing analytics dimensions. Make and n8n can orchestrate the data flow between MailerCheck's API and Adobe Analytics' data import features. For simpler implementations, export data from both platforms to a shared database or data warehouse (like BigQuery or Snowflake) and analyze them together using Adobe Analytics Workspace or a separate BI tool.
Here is a practical guide for integrating MailerCheck email verification data with Adobe Analytics for enriched marketing insights.
Ensure your Adobe Analytics implementation tracks email sign-up events with relevant context. Set up custom events for email submissions and capture associated dimensions such as the traffic source, landing page, campaign ID, and form location. If you are not already hashing or tokenizing the email address in a custom variable, consider doing so for matching purposes while maintaining privacy.
Create an automated process that takes email addresses submitted through your website forms and sends them to MailerCheck for verification. This can be done in real time (verifying each email as it is submitted) or in batch (collecting a day's submissions and verifying them together). Use your automation platform or a custom script to call MailerCheck's API and store the verification results.
Use Adobe Analytics' Classifications feature or Data Sources to import MailerCheck verification results. Create a classification for the email identifier dimension that includes the verification status (valid, invalid, risky, disposable, role-based). This allows you to break down any Adobe Analytics report by email quality without modifying your website tracking code.
In Adobe Analytics Workspace, create reports and dashboards that incorporate the email verification dimension. Build visualizations showing email quality distribution by traffic source, conversion rate comparison between visitors with valid versus invalid emails, and trend analysis of email quality over time. Set up alerts for significant drops in email quality that might indicate bot activity or form abuse.
Use the combined data to make actionable decisions. Reallocate marketing budget toward channels that produce higher-quality email sign-ups. Implement real-time MailerCheck verification on forms that show high rates of invalid submissions. Create Adobe Analytics segments for valid-email visitors to use in retargeting and lookalike audience creation.
